cw: war/violence Stubby...participated in four offensives and 17 battles. He entered combat on February 5, 1918, and was under constant fire, day and night for over a month. In April, Stubby was wounded in the foreleg by the retreating Germans throwing hand grenades. He was sent to the rear for convalescence, and as he had done on the front was able to improve morale...After being gasses, Stubby learned to warn his unit of poison gas attacks, located wounded soldiers in no mans land, and - since he could hear the whine of incoming artillery shells before humans could - became very adept at letting his unit know when to duck for cover.
